Mobility Scooter to Buy Near Me

A mobility scooter allows users to move around freely without relying on anyone else. It's also a great way to keep people active and engaged with their family and friends.

The first thing to consider when selecting the best buy mobility scooter near me scooter is where you intend to use it. The majority of mobility scooters have rubber or foam filled tires that will never wear out. However, pneumatic wheels can provide more comfort and a smoother ride.

Brands

The model of scooter you pick will have a major impact on the price you pay as different companies charge differently for their products. Certain manufacturers offer cheaper scooters, while others produce high-end models that can be more than $5,000. The price of a mobility scooter is influenced by a variety of factors such as the size and type of the battery, motor wheels, and other accessories.

The top scooter brands offer an excellent level of customer service and also a variety of options to their customers. Certain brands offer financing to help with the initial cost. They will allow you to test out a model prior to making an purchase, which is an excellent way to get an idea of what a particular scooter can do.

Pride Mobility has been in business since 1986 and is among the most well-known brands in the business. Their product line includes scooters, power chairs, and other durable medical equipment. The company is based in Pennsylvania and has more than 30 locations nationwide. Their scooters are equipped with a variety of features, including swivel seats and lightweight frames. The company offers a lifetime frame warranty and two-year warranties on the powertrain and electronics.

Drive Medical is one of the most well-known brands of scooters available in local medical supply stores. The company specializes in compact and travel scooters, which are ideal for use in the home or on short trips. The models offered by the company are ideal for people who are older and have back or hip issues. The company also provides a number of special features that make its scooters suitable for those with limited mobility.

Another great option is EV Rider which provides a variety of scooters that can be used for a variety of mobility needs. The brand's sport-style scooters are popular among those who seek an item that is not only functional, but also attractive. The company is well-known in the online market and provides excellent customer service.

Prices are a little higher than normal.

The price of a mobility vehicle can vary based on the type, size, and features. Some models are more expensive and have more advanced technology. Choose what you want and which features are important to you prior to you begin your search for the perfect scooter. You should also consider the frequency you utilize the scooter and where you will be using it most frequently. For example, if you will be taking it on trips you must choose one that folds easily and fits in the trunk of your car.

The number of wheels on a scooter is also a factor in the price. Four-wheeled scooters are more stable and suited for riding on rough terrain than three-wheeled models. They can also carry heavier loads and are less likely to tip. They are typically more expensive than travel or folding scooters.

When you are choosing a mobility scooter, you should also take into account the battery's life and maximum speed. The greater the speed, the more quickly you'll be able to travel. You should also consider whether you want to add additional accessories to your scooter, such as bags or a rearview mirror. While the majority of scooters come with these items, some seniors prefer to upgrade their devices with more useful features. Medicare will only pay for certain features if they're medically required.

A mobility scooter is an ideal option for those who aren't able to walk long distances or require assistance to get around. It lets them shop without a helper or enjoy the outdoors. It could also allow them to travel to far-off places, such as their family's home. In addition it can provide a sense of independence to those who aren't willing to ask for assistance.

A good quality mobility scooter will have a long battery life and will be able to handle rough terrain. Most scooters have suspension systems to help improve the ride. Some models even have flat-free tires. However, it is important to maintain your scooter regularly to ensure it lasts longer.

A mobility scooter is a single-occupant electronic transportation vehicle designed to help people with physical limitations. They are usually battery powered and have either three or four wheels. The handlebar is buy used mobility scooter to steer the scooter. They can be ridden either on pavements, sidewalks or roads based on their speed. Many scooters have a basket, horn, and lights. Some scooters fold up to make transportation more convenient.

The right scooter for you is based on your preferences and requirements. There are a few important aspects to keep in mind when making your decision, including the weight capacity, turning radius, and the maximum speed of the scooter. The weight capacity is the maximum weight that the scooter can handle, and the turning radius is how much are mobility scooters to buy far it can travel in a single direction. The maximum speed of the scooter will vary depending on terrain, incline, and the passenger's weight.

The majority of the research on mobility scooters focuses on their relationship to their prevalence within the population and user perspectives. However, there are studies that study the physical and physical abilities that are impacted by mobility scooters. These studies suggest that the use of a mobility scooter can help people maintain their walking independence and maintain their ability to walk as they did before using the device.

There are some limitations on the use of mobility scooters that must be considered, for instance the fact that they might not be able to fit in public buildings particularly older ones that were not designed with accessibility in mind. It is also possible that they will be unable to maneuver through narrow hallways or the "privacy wall" in most washrooms. It is, therefore, recommended that a medical examination be carried out prior to purchasing a mobility scooter to ensure that it meets the individual's medical and functional requirements.
